This doesn't apply to a turbocharger exit. N/A...

This doesn't apply to a turbocharger exit. N/A engine exhaust ports produce pulsed flow as a factor of valve opening/closing events. This pulsed flow results in compression and expansion waves...

There will always be a little bit of play when...

There will always be a little bit of play when you pry up on the control arm since the ball is supported by a spring which is not at full compression. On a track car the control arms should be...
